- Sex hormone-binding globulin (SHBG) or sex steroid-binding globulin (SSBG) is a glycoprotein that binds to androgens and estrogens. (wikipedia.org)
- SHBG inhibits the function of these hormones. (wikipedia.org)
- Thus, the local bioavailability of sex hormones is influenced by the level of SHBG. (wikipedia.org)
- Because SHBG binds to testosterone (T) and dihydrotestosterone (DHT), these hormones are made less lipophilic and become concentrated within the luminal fluid of the seminiferous tubules. (wikipedia.org)
- DHT binds to SHBG with about 5 times the affinity of testosterone and about 20 times the affinity of estradiol. (wikipedia.org)
- Dehydroepiandrosterone (DHEA) is weakly bound to SHBG, but dehydroepiandrosterone sulfate is not bound to SHBG. (wikipedia.org)
- Androstenedione is not bound to SHBG either, and is instead bound solely to albumin. (wikipedia.org)
- Estrone sulfate and estriol are also poorly bound by SHBG. (wikipedia.org)
- Less than 1% of progesterone is bound to SHBG. (wikipedia.org)
- Testes-produced SHBG is called androgen-binding protein. (wikipedia.org)
- The mechanism of activating the promoter for SHBG in the liver involves hepatocyte nuclear factor 4 alpha (HNF4A) binding to a DR1 like cis element which then stimulate production. (wikipedia.org)
- If HNF4A level is low then COUP-TF binds to the first site and turns off production of SHBG. (wikipedia.org)
- SHBG has two laminin G-like domains which form pockets that bind hydrophobic molecules. (wikipedia.org)
- Most of the circulating testosterone is bound to carrier proteins (sex hormone-binding globulin [SHBG], and albumin). (cdc.gov)
- Sex hormone-binding globulin (SHBG) is the blood transport protein for androgens and estrogens. (cdc.gov)
- SHBG has a high binding affinity to dihydrotestosterone (DHT), medium affinity to testosterone and estradiol, and only a low affinity to estrone, dehydroepiandrosterone (DHEA), androstendione, and estriol. (cdc.gov)
- Albumin, which exists in far higher concentrations than SHBG, also binds sexual steroids - although with a clearly lower binding affinity (e.g. about 100 times lower for testosterone). (cdc.gov)

- To determine whether hyperinsulinemia can directly reduce serum sex hormone-binding globulin (SHBG) levels in obese women with the polycystic ovary syndrome, six obese women with this disorder were studied. (qxmd.com)
- Due primarily to the rise in serum SHBG levels, serum non-SHBG-bound testosterone levels fell by 43% from 19 +/- 5 pmol/L on day 0 to 11 +/- 4 pmol/L on day 10 (P = 0.05). (qxmd.com)
- These observations suggest that hyperinsulinemia directly reduces serum SHBG levels in obese women with the polycystic ovary syndrome independently of any effect on serum sex steroids. (qxmd.com)
